Output f809761ab79bfccf3233d0f12e376f1aa982f4485587af1b81c89a32a43b1da3:2

value
232414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83abd05e83ebce842bc88ad0fd1f234b18ef5db2 OP_EQUAL
address
3DhEGWrV4uujSNJWmUC18Q8DJdTQBpt7e7
transaction
f809761ab79bfccf3233d0f12e376f1aa982f4485587af1b81c89a32a43b1da3
spent
true